ORTHODOX UNION PRESENTS “NAVIGATE THE BACK TO SCHOOL DAZE,” NATIONAL WEEKLONG SERIES OF WEBCASTS ON POSITIVE JEWISH PARENTING, SEPTEMBER 10-13

The Orthodox Union Department of Community Engagement | Jewish Community Programs and the Life section on the OU website, www.ou.org, will present “Navigate the Back to School Daze” — a week-long series of webcasts for a national audience by leading Orthodox mental health and rabbinic professionals focusing on how to transition from summer vacation back to the school year. The presentations, during which speakers will also be available for live interaction, will take place at 7:00 p.m. EDT from Monday, September 10 through Thursday, September 13.

The webcasts, coordinated by Hannah Farkas, OU Community Engagement Program Associate, are a component of the OU Community Engagement on-going “Positive Jewish Parenting” programs. Topics of discussion throughout the week will include:

• Monday, September 10:
“Positive Limit Setting With Our Children”
Rachel Pill, L.C.S.W.

• Tuesday, September 11:
“Improve Your Children’s Self-Esteem and Motivate Them to Learn”
Adina Soclof, MS, CCC-SLP

• Wednesday, September 12
“Communicating With Your Child’s School – How to Talk So They Will Listen”
Alex Bailey, Ph.D.

• Thursday, September 13
“We’ve Got Ruach, Yes We Do! Transitioning the Spirituality of Summer Experiences into the Home”
Rabbi Yaakov Glasser, Regional Director of New Jersey NCSY
